Key Cost Factors

House raising in Harrison Township, MI, involves elevating a structure to protect it from flooding, improve foundation stability, or meet local elevation requirements. The scope and complexity of house raising projects can vary based on several factors, influencing the overall costs and procedures involved.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.

  • Materials: Use of durable foundation supports, piers, and framing components suitable for residential structures.
  • Size and Scope: Projects range from small single-story homes to larger multi-level structures, impacting the extent of work required.
  • Labor Complexity: Involves structural assessment, careful lifting, and stabilization, requiring specialized skills and equipment.
  • Permitting: Local permits are typically necessary to ensure compliance with Harrison Township building codes and regulations.
  • Additional Services: May include foundation repairs, utility disconnects and reconnects, and site grading as part of the house raising process.
